1969 Ford Corsair vs. 1978 Ford Capri

To start off, 1978 Ford Capri is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Ford Corsair.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Ford Corsair would be higher. At 1,498 cc (4 cylinders), 1969 Ford Corsair is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Ford Corsair (59 HP) has 6 more horse power than 1978 Ford Capri. (53 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1969 Ford Corsair should accelerate faster than 1978 Ford Capri.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1978 Ford Capri weights approximately 105 kg more than 1969 Ford Corsair.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1969 Ford Corsair (101 Nm @ 2300 RPM) has 16 more torque (in Nm) than 1978 Ford Capri. (85 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1969 Ford Corsair will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1978 Ford Capri.

Compare all specifications:

1969 Ford Corsair 1978 Ford Capri
Make Ford Ford
Model Corsair Capri
Year Released 1969 1978
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1498 cc 1298 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 59 HP 53 HP
Torque 101 Nm 85 Nm
Torque RPM 2300 RPM 3000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 81 mm 79 mm
Engine Stroke Size 72.7 mm 66 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 885 kg 990 kg
Vehicle Length 4500 mm 4380 mm
Vehicle Width 1620 mm 1700 mm
Vehicle Height 1460 mm 1330 mm
Wheelbase Size 2570 mm 2570 mm
